Our bodies do burn more calories in the days running up to TTOM - but we're talking about 200 per day not thousands!
I tend to give into the cravings but with small portions (one slice of pizza or a 1/4 cup of chocolate fudge ice cream or 20 g of fudge, etc.). I don't know why we get the specific cravings we do - other than that the need for extra iron/magnesium seems to trigger chocolate cravings in most women. Your body does burn SLIGHTLY more during TTOM and the days leaning up to it, but not too many more than normal! Many people do use that as an excuse ("I'm losing blood! I must need WAY more calories than normal!" or something like that) but the reality is that unless you have some sort of menstrual problem/disorder, you won't need more, you'll just WANT more.

Try making your own alternatives to things.
For example, if you want a pizza, take a 100 calorie whole wheat tortilla, add on 50 calories of some kind of premade sauce like prego, and sprinkle 100 calories of half skim milk mozzarella. Bake in toaster oven or a regular oven until the tortilla is crispy. Only 250ish calories and it's like eating 3-4 slices of extra thin pizza!
Ok... here is a first year med student's thoughts on the whole thing haha.... So after you ovulate, your body begins producing a lot of this hormone called progesterone. It peaks about a week before your period starts (assuming you're not pregnant), and then falls off and that's when menstruation (bleeding) begins. Progesterone is "the hormone of pregnancy," so I kind of think of the week before my period as being a bit like pregnancy haha. Although the levels of progesterone are MUCH MUCH higher during pregnancy and last for 40 weeks instead of a few days. I'm pretty sure (but not completely... didn't do a medline search or anything!!) that progesterone is the reason we want to eat a lot, get painful boobs, etc. It's biologically good to want to eat more during pregnancy because you're trying to grow another human, but during our menstrual cycles it's just annoying!
